The PARKER 165HD-6 is a brass compression tube union designed to join two compression-end tube lines in a single inline connection. It accepts compression fittings on both ends, creating a secure, leak-resistant joint without soldering or threading. Rated to 1500 psi maximum working pressure and sized for 3/8 inch outside diameter tubing, this union is built for demanding service in refrigeration, HVAC, and fluid-system applications. Plumbers, refrigeration mechanics, and HVAC technicians install this fitting where a straight union connection is needed between two compression tube runs.
This union is suited for residential and light commercial installations involving copper or compatible tubing at 3/8 inch OD. Typical applications include refrigerant line repairs, water supply connections, and instrument tubing assemblies where a reliable compression-style union is required. The all-brass construction resists corrosion and holds up in wet or humid environments common to mechanical rooms and utility spaces.
Designed as an OEM-style replacement and service fitting for compression tube systems using 3/8 inch outside diameter tubing with standard compression connections.
Installation is performed by licensed plumbers or HVAC technicians following applicable IPC or IMC guidelines. Shut off and depressurize the line before disassembly or fitting installation. Hand-tighten the compression nut onto the tube, then advance with a wrench per standard compression fitting practice — do not overtighten, as excessive torque can deform the ferrule and cause leaks. Pressure-test the connection before returning the system to service.
